At Manipal Hospitals, the internal medicine doctors in Siliguri deliver specialised and comprehensive care for adults. These experts diagnose and treat a wide range of diseases, including both acute and chronic illnesses. They are often the first point of contact for individuals seeking accurate diagnosis, long-term care, or preventive health screenings. Patients should consult an internal medicine doctor if they experience unexplained fever, chronic cough, or persistent fatigue. Joint pain and digestive issues are also common reasons. Those with long-term conditions such as diabetes or hypertension should seek regular evaluation from an internal medicine specialist.

Internal medicine specialists offer various services. Some of them are:

  • Diabetes and thyroid disorders.

  • Respiratory conditions like asthma and bronchitis.

  • Infectious diseases.

  • Cardiovascular risk management (e.g., high BP, cholesterol, obesity).

  • Autoimmune diseases.

  • Liver and kidney disorders.

Internal medicine doctors are trained to manage patients with more than one health issue at a time, like diabetes, high blood pressure, or thyroid problems. They also work closely with other specialists when needed to make sure the patient gets the right care and follow-up. This helps in keeping the overall health in check and avoiding complications.
